Apply for the ‘Water Governance for Future Leaders’ Program

The Arab Water Academy and the USAID encourages the brightest middle managers working in the water sector to apply for its first capacity development program which will be held on 28 June-2 July 2009.

This program aims to help future water leaders explore -in depth- the nature and complexities of governance and its implication for addressing cutting edge water issues in the Arab world. The program is designed for middle management in Egypt , Jordan , Morocco , Oman and United Arab Emirates who operate in the field of water at a strategic level in ministries, government agencies, private sector, public sector, civil society organizations and academic institutions.


The program, delivered by international and regional experts thus seeks to:

1. Develop an understanding of the concepts, roles, and practices of effective water governance

2. Enable participants to identify and analyze critical governance-related problems in the water sector

3. Enable participants to design ideas and develop leadership capabilities to bring about change in water governance

4. Develop a close support network of colleagues both within and across countries


The course is free of charge and the Arab Water Academy will cover travel and hotel accommodation (according to AWA criteria).
